What people use each for
The jobs each tool is most often brought in to do.
Backbase
- An established bank wanting to modernise its digital customer experience without replacing its core banking systemnot Dwolla
- A credit union wanting purpose-built digital onboarding and servicing workflowsnot Dwolla
- A newer bank wanting an engagement layer built for AI-driven interaction from the outsetnot Dwolla
- A bank consolidating several separate digital banking front ends into one platform across retail and business bankingnot Dwolla
Dwolla
- An insurance or lending platform disbursing funds to customer bank accounts where card payout fees would destroy the marginnot Backbase
- A B2B marketplace collecting large invoice payments by bank transfer rather than paying interchange on cardsnot Backbase
- A payroll or gig platform that needs to pay workers instantly and wants the rail chosen automatically by receiving bank capabilitynot Backbase
- A property management system collecting rent by ACH with verified bank accounts and reliable return handlingnot Backbase
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Backbase
- Pricing scales with assets under management and AI API calls, meaning cost grows as the bank itself grows and adopts more AI features, which is a less predictable cost curve than a flat per-seat model.
- It sits above, not instead of, a core banking system, so adopting it does not reduce a bank's overall vendor count or technology complexity; it adds a specialised layer.
- As with any customer-facing banking platform, an outage or performance issue directly affects the bank's customers, so the operational stakes of vendor reliability are high.
- Implementation for a large bank spans multiple modules and integration points, and realistic timelines run well beyond a simple software rollout.
- Pricing opacity means a bank cannot benchmark Backbase against competing engagement banking platforms without engaging each vendor's own sales process separately.
Dwolla
- Nothing is published: there are no per-transaction rates, no platform fee and no minimum on the pricing page, so every buyer negotiates blind and small platforms have no way to sanity check what they are quoted.
- It is payments only, with no deposit accounts, card issuing or general ledger, so companies embedding financial products need at least one further vendor and the reconciliation between them.
- Instant payment reach depends on the receiving institution supporting RTP or FedNow, so a meaningful share of payouts still fall back to ACH timing regardless of what the API can do.
- ACH returns and administrative returns remain your operational problem, and platforms new to bank rails routinely underestimate the customer support load that failed debits generate.
- Access to instant rails runs through Dwolla banking partner, which reintroduces a bank dependency into a product that otherwise avoids sponsor bank programme risk.

Answered from the vendors’ own pages
Backbase: Does Backbase replace our core banking system?
No, it is a customer engagement layer that sits above and integrates with an existing core banking system.
Dwolla: What does Dwolla cost?
It does not publish anything. Pricing is custom and built around volume, rails and integration. Establish the monthly platform fee and any minimum before negotiating per-transaction rates.
Backbase: How does pricing work?
It scales with factors including number of users, modules implemented, assets under management and AI API calls; exact numbers require a quote.
Dwolla: Does it support instant payments?
Yes, through both the RTP network and the FedNow Service, with automatic selection based on the receiving bank. Where neither is supported, payments fall back to ACH.
Backbase: Is it suited to business as well as retail banking?
Yes, it includes modules specifically for small business banking engagement alongside retail.
Dwolla: Is Dwolla a bank?
No. It is a payments platform that works through banking partners. It does not offer deposit accounts or card issuing.
Dwolla: How does bank account verification work?
Either instantly through open banking connections or by micro-deposit verification, which takes a day or two but works where instant linking fails.
